UPVC Window Repair Near Me

Windows are a crucial element of every home. They keep out air, water, noise and pollution. However, they may be damaged or broken over time. In some instances, professional repairs may be required to correct these issues.

UPVC windows are now in high demand due to their strength and low maintenance requirements. They also help you save money on your energy bills.

UPVC window lock repair

uPVC is a popular choice for renovations and new homes. These windows offer many benefits, such as durability as well as ease of maintenance and energy efficiency. These windows are BPA and phthalate free and therefore safer for children to use. They are also rust-proof, and don't require painting or varnishing to keep them looking their best. They aren't susceptible to warping or rotting and are easy to maintain. Despite their strength and ease in maintenance, uPVC can sometimes develop problems that need professional attention. These issues could include a draughty or broken window, a broken lock, or a broken handle.

uPVC window and door locks may become damaged over the years because of wear and tear or accidental damage. This makes them less secure and more vulnerable to burglaries. This is why it is crucial to fix these components as soon as possible. You can hire a double glazed window repairs-glazing expert in your area to complete this. This type of specialist has been trained to complete a broad range of repairs and upgrades for uPVC windows and doors. They also can recommend other security products such as door viewers.

A gap between the frame of the sash and the frame may be the reason behind your windows not closing properly. This can lead to draughts, however it could also cause damp and water damage. To determine this, try putting a piece paper between the frame and the sash to see if the frame can be sealed.

To fix this, you will need to remove the seal around the frame and the sash. You will then need to remove the locking mechanism from its place inside the frame. This will require the assistance of a tool, like an flat screwdriver or torch to access it. After you have removed the gearbox, you'll need to replace it with a brand new one with the same type and size.

Repair UPVC window frames

If your uPVC windows are damaged, have cracks or holes, or damaged window seals It is crucial to repair them right away. These problems can cause the glass of your windows to become cloudy and could also cause water leaks. Additionally, frame damage can reduce the insulation value of your home and cause higher energy bills. Most of these problems are easily addressed by a professional or a DIY repair.

UPVC window repairs are less expensive than replacement of the entire unit, but in some instances, it's better to replace the entire unit. This is especially true if the frame is damaged beyond repair. The cost of the UPVC replacement window is influenced by a variety of factors, including the type of material and the amount of labor involved. A full replacement costs between $100 and $1,000 for a window, and the cost will vary depending on the severity of the damage and whether replacement is required.

It is vital to clean UPVC windows regularly to prevent the accumulation of dirt and moisture. This will allow you to avoid costly repairs later on. In general, you should do this two times a year. You may also apply WD-40 to grease the moving parts of your UPVC window. Before cleaning the frame, it is recommended to get rid of any cobwebs or dust with a soft bristle brush. You can also sand any scuff marks on the frames to make them appear like new.
